Package org.keycloak.theme
Class DefaultThemeManager
- java.lang.Object
-
- org.keycloak.theme.DefaultThemeManager
-
- All Implemented Interfaces:
org.keycloak.models.ThemeManager
public class DefaultThemeManager extends Object implements org.keycloak.models.ThemeManager
- Author:
- Stian Thorgersen
-
-
Constructor Summary
Constructors Constructor Description DefaultThemeManager(DefaultThemeManagerFactory factory, org.keycloak.models.KeycloakSession session)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
clearCache()
org.keycloak.theme.Theme
getTheme(String name, org.keycloak.theme.Theme.Type type)
org.keycloak.theme.Theme
getTheme(org.keycloak.theme.Theme.Type type)
boolean
isCacheEnabled()
Set<String>
nameSet(org.keycloak.theme.Theme.Type type)
-
-
-
Constructor Detail
-
DefaultThemeManager
public DefaultThemeManager(DefaultThemeManagerFactory factory, org.keycloak.models.KeycloakSession session)
-
-
Method Detail
-
getTheme
public org.keycloak.theme.Theme getTheme(org.keycloak.theme.Theme.Type type)
- Specified by:
getTheme
in interfaceorg.keycloak.models.ThemeManager
-
getTheme
public org.keycloak.theme.Theme getTheme(String name, org.keycloak.theme.Theme.Type type)
- Specified by:
getTheme
in interfaceorg.keycloak.models.ThemeManager
-
nameSet
public Set<String> nameSet(org.keycloak.theme.Theme.Type type)
- Specified by:
nameSet
in interfaceorg.keycloak.models.ThemeManager
-
isCacheEnabled
public boolean isCacheEnabled()
- Specified by:
isCacheEnabled
in interfaceorg.keycloak.models.ThemeManager
-
clearCache
public void clearCache()
- Specified by:
clearCache
in interfaceorg.keycloak.models.ThemeManager
-
-